Dassault Systèmes joins UK's National Composites Centre

Inaugurated in November 2011 and located in the Bristol & Bath Science Park, the National Composites Centre (NCC) provides its members with a collaborative modelling and simulation environment based on Dassault Systèmes’ V6 solutions to develop innovative composites products. Companies will be able to explore, test and validate design, as well as engineering and manufacturing options.

"With Version 6, Dassault Systèmes provides NCC with a complete, open and fully integrated design, simulation and virtual manufacturing 3D Experience system", says Peter Chivers, Chief Executive of the NCC.

"Our mission in developing composite product manufacturing knowledge excellence will be greatly helped by Dassault Systèmes who will in return benefit from NCC’s industry knowledge.”
